1. A handle arrangement comprising:
a handle moveable between a stowed position, a deployed position and an operative position in which the handle causes the unlatch of a door;
a latch lever for unlatching the door;
a deploying system pivotally coupled with the handle and comprising a front lever and a rear lever each cooperating with an end of the handle, the rear lever comprising a first driving member that, in the stowed and deployed positions of the handle, is spaced apart from the latch lever and, in the operative position of the handle, actuates the latch lever to unlatch the door; and
a blocking system comprising an inertial rotor configured to be driven in rotation by an inertial force from a rest position to a preventing position,
wherein the blocking system further comprises a bridge moveable about a pivot axis between a disengaged position and an engaged position, wherein the bridge comprises an engagement arm that, in the disengaged position, is spaced apart from the latch lever and, in the engaged position, engages the latch lever to prevent the unlatching of the door, and
wherein the bridge further comprises an actuating arm configured to cooperate with the inertial rotor when the latter moves from the rest position to the preventing position, such cooperation moving the bridge from the disengaged position and the engaged position.
